Chinese Illegal Immigrant Arrested After Entering Marine Corps Base and Refusing to Leave

An illegal immigrant from China was arrested after entering the largest Marine Corps base in the country without authorization and refusing to leave.

A Chinese national confirmed to be an illegal immigrant was arrested last week after sneaking onto a military base in California and ignoring orders to leave, according to an official from U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P).

CBP’s El Centro Sector Chief Patrol Agent Gregory Bovino said in a March 29 post on social media platform X that agents were called out to a Marine Corps base about a Chinese national who entered the facility without authorization and failed to respond to orders to leave.

“Subject was confirmed to be in the country illegally,” Mr. Bovino wrote, noting that his purpose in entering the base remains under investigation.

U.S. Marine Corps didn’t respond by press time to The Epoch Times’ requests for more details on the incident.

However, The Epoch Times has learned on background from CBP sources that the Chinese national tried to enter the Marine Corps Air Ground Combat Center in Twentynine Palms, California, without authorization. Border Patrol agents were called to the scene and took the individual into custody, transporting him to a nearby station for further processing.

The facility, also known as Twentynine Palms, is the largest U.S. Marine Corps base in the country.

The latest breach comes amid numerous instances of Chinese nationals infiltrating U.S. military bases over the past several years.

For instance, two Chinese nationals were arrested for illegally entering and taking photos at a U.S. Navy base in Florida in 2020, and a recent report by The Wall Street Journal estimates that there have been more than 100 similar incidents over the past few years.

The head of the Border Patrol union recently warned about a sharp rise in the number of military-aged Chinese men crossing the U.S.–Mexico border illegally, which dovetails with CBP data.
